Abstract

The invention belongs to the field of fitness equipment, and relates to swimming training equipment. Solves the problems that the swimming action simulation is insufficient and the whole body exercise effect cannot be achieved when the swimming simulation body-building equipment in the prior art is used. The swimming training device comprises a frame and a horizontal base arranged at the bottom of the frame, wherein the base is provided with a foot standing position for a human body, a trainer stands on a standing surface to finish the swimming action of legs, and a counterweight tension rod component capable of driving the arms of the trainer to finish the swimming and rowing gesture is movably connected above the standing surface and positioned on the frame and can be lifted up and down along the vertical direction. The invention has simple and compact structure, low requirements on hardware facilities such as space position and the like, and extremely strong universality. By using the swimming training device, the completed actions highly simulate breaststroke postures, and a trainer can mobilize whole body muscle groups including lower limbs, waist, abdomen and the like during body building training.

Swimming training apparatus
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the field of fitness equipment, and relates to swimming training equipment.
Background
With the increase of the material level, people pay more attention to the physical health and the beauty of the body. Swimming is an effective systemic body-building mode, in particular to breaststroke which has good effects on developing muscle groups of human bodies, strengthening bodies and shaping bodies, can help people to correct certain abnormal body shapes, and can lead organisms and muscles of all parts of the bodies to be evenly and comprehensively developed. However, swimming has high requirements on environments such as temperature, places and the like, the fixed cost of sports is high, and swimming is a sport with high technical requirements, and particularly, a person who does not know the swimming technology can hardly complete the sport. Therefore, various fitness apparatuses for simulating swimming are developed in the market, for example, chinese patent literature discloses a fitness trainer based on swimming simulation [ application number: 201210048830.2], a fitness person leans down on a bearing plate and a hanging frame sticking buckle fixed on a hanging frame, an auxiliary person adjusts arm rods and leg rods to proper lengths and fixes the arm rods and the leg rods by screws, the fitness person sleeves arms and the legs into corresponding arm rod sticking buckles and leg rod sticking buckles, then the auxiliary person buckles all the sticking buckles, and the fitness person can start swimming simulation.
However, the above-mentioned scheme also has the disadvantage that, the body-building person needs another person to assist its body-building training ware of adjusting swimming simulation, can not alone accomplish body-building motion, and in addition, the body-building person lies prone on the bearing plate, and the body-building person supports the effect that can not move and can not reach whole body coordinated motion on the bearing plate, even the improvement mode that partly unsettled still can not avoid this problem.
In addition, the Chinese patent literature also discloses a swimming high-pull trainer [201220443000.5], wherein a user adjusts a strong magnetic bolt on the weight plate to determine the exercise intensity, then the user sits on the seat cushion, lifts the body into a vertical posture, grips the pull ring by two hands, pulls the weight plate downwards, and simulates swimming action according to the self condition, so that the aim of training is achieved.
The above proposal has good body-building effect on the upper body muscle groups such as the back muscle, the deltoid muscle, the biceps brachii, the pectoral large muscle and the like, but because the body-building adopts sitting postures, the movement amplitude of the lower body and the trunk is small, and compared with swimming, the effect of whole body movement cannot be achieved.

Detailed Description
The invention will be described in further detail with reference to the drawings and the detailed description.
As shown in fig. 1-3, the swimming training apparatus comprises a frame 1, a horizontal base 2 is arranged at the bottom of the frame 1, a standing surface 21 for standing and positioning feet of a human body and a positioning inclined surface 22 obliquely arranged downwards along the standing surface 21 are arranged on the base, and a counterweight tension rod assembly 3 capable of driving arms of a trainer to finish swimming and drawing is movably connected above the standing surface 21 and is positioned on the frame 1 and can vertically and vertically ascend and descend.
Preferably, the middle of the positioning inclined plane 22 is provided with a spacer block 23, a plurality of first inserting holes 24 are symmetrically arranged on the positioning inclined plane 22 and positioned on two sides of the spacer block 23, in order to fix the instep by force when a trainer performs swimming and leg folding actions, two sides of the spacer block 23 and positioned on the positioning inclined plane 22 are respectively symmetrically provided with at least one foot stop lever 25 which is detachably connected in the first inserting holes 24, the foot stop lever 25 can be inserted into the corresponding first inserting holes 24 according to the figure of the trainer to play an accurate blocking role, a plurality of second inserting holes 26 are symmetrically arranged on the standing surface 21 and along the central line of the standing surface 21, in order to prevent the foot from sliding backwards when the trainer completes swimming and leg stretching, a plurality of foot stop levers 25 are inserted into the second inserting holes 26, and the foot stop levers 25 can be inserted into the corresponding second inserting holes 26 according to the foot size of the trainer to play an effective blocking role.
Preferably, to ensure comfort and safety of the foot of the trainer, the foot bar is covered with a sponge cover with phi of 75 x 132.
In this swimming training apparatus, counter weight pulling force pole subassembly 3 include one with frame 1 swing joint and can follow the pulling force pole pipe 31 that vertical direction goes up and down, pulling force pole pipe 31 the centre be connected with a wire rope 32, preferably, adopt wire rope 32 that specification is phi 6, the wire rope 32 other end is connected with balancing weight subassembly 4, pulling force pole pipe 31 on and overlap respectively at wire rope 32 both sides and have a handle ring 33 that can follow pulling force pole pipe 31 axial slip, the training person holds when handle change 33 downward pulling, can make the arm action of drawing water when swimming.
At least one sliding block 34 is arranged at two ends of the round tube 31 of the tension rod respectively, a guide shaft 35 matched with the sliding block 34 is arranged on the frame 1 and at two ends of the round tube 31 of the tension rod respectively, and the sliding block 34 is sleeved on the guide shaft 35 so that the sliding block 34 can slide along the guide shaft 35.
Preferably, in order to ensure that the sliding block can flexibly and smoothly run along the guide shaft, a linear bearing 36 is arranged in the sliding block 34, the linear bearing 36 is sleeved outside the guide shaft 35 and is in sliding connection with the guide shaft 35, the guide shaft 35 is perpendicular to the round tube 31 of the tension rod, and the guide shaft 35 is fixedly arranged on the frame 1.
A transverse truss 11 is fixedly connected above the frame 1, a group of pulley blocks 12 are fixedly connected at the front end and the rear end of the transverse truss 11 respectively, and a steel wire rope 32 is arranged in the pulley blocks 12 in a penetrating mode. The pulley block 12 comprises two pulleys 121 which are arranged in parallel, pulley grooves 122 on the two pulleys 121 are combined to form a steel wire rope groove 123 for limiting the movement of the steel wire rope 32, and the steel wire rope 32 is respectively connected with the round tube 31 of the tension rod and the balancing weight component 4 through the rear two ends of the steel wire rope groove 123 in the two groups of pulley blocks 12.
The counterweight assembly 4 includes a counterweight housing 41 and a plurality of counterweights 42 positioned within the counterweight housing 41. Preferably, the weight box 41 is provided with a weight recognition display system 43, and those skilled in the art will recognize that the weight recognition display system 43 may be a spring balance or an electronic balance, and display the weight with a display.
Preferably, in order to ensure the safety of the trainers during exercise, the left and right sides of the frame 1 are fixedly provided with protective rods 13.
The application method of the invention comprises the following steps:
1. before training, a proper balancing weight is selected according to a trainer, the two feet of the trainer stand on the base, the heels face inwards, the toes face towards two sides to form a straight shape, and the outer sides of the feet lean against the foot stop lever.
2. The hands grasp the handles on the transverse tube and pull the handles downwards until the lower legs of the training person touch the inclined surface of the base.
3. Standing by using the tension of the balancing weight; the above actions are repeated, and the endurance and explosive force of the legs and feet and the arms of the trainer are exercised.
